Celtic seals fifth consecutive Scottish Premiership title

Celtic came from behind to beat Hearts 3-1 and clinch their fifth straight Scottish Premiership title on the final day of the season.

The match at Celtic Park began with Hearts taking the lead in the 43rd minute through a header from Stephen Shankland. Celtic responded with a penalty converted by Arne Engels in first-half stoppage time to level the score at 1-1.

Hearts came from behind to defeat Rangers 2-1 at Tynecastle on Sunday, restoring a three-point lead over Celtic at the top of the Scottish Premiership. Lawrence Shankland's winning goal dealt a major blow to Rangers' title hopes. The result moves Hearts seven points clear of Rangers with three games remaining.

Brighton & Hove Albion defeated Chelsea 3-0 at the Amex Stadium, extending the Blues' winless Premier League run to five matches without scoring. Ferdi Kadioglu opened the scoring in the third minute, followed by Jack Hinshelwood in the 56th and Danny Welbeck late on. The result saw Brighton leapfrog Chelsea into sixth place.
